如何选择以太坊以便于发币:全面指南
随着加密货币市场的蓬勃发展,越来越多的人开始关注如何通过以太坊(Ethereum)网络发币。在这个过程中,选择一个合适的是至关重要的。本文将深入探讨以太坊的各种选项,如何在这些中发币,并提供使用过程中需要注意的事项。
首先,我们要了解以太坊的基本类型,包括热和冷。热是指在线,用户可以随时访问和控制自己的资产,而冷则是指不连接互联网的离线,适合长期存储。无论选择哪种,重要的是它需要支持ERC20代币的创建和管理。接下来,我们将逐步了解不同的优缺点以及它们在发币过程中的适用性。
以太坊的类型
在以太坊生态系统中,用户可以选择多种类型的,这些根据其安全性、便捷性和功能有不同的特点。
- 热: 热通常是指通过网络接口提供服务的应用程序,如MetaMask、MyEtherWallet等。这类便于快速交易和操作,但因其连接互联网,也更容易受到黑客攻击。对于频繁交易和发币的用户,热无疑是一个不错的选择。 - 冷: 冷有多种形式,如硬件(Ledger、Trezor)和纸质。冷虽然不方便频繁操作,但其安全性极高,适合长期存储大量的以太坊及其关联代币。如果用户在发币后继续持有代币,而不是频繁交易,冷将是一个更安全的选择。 - 桌面: 这些是安装在电脑上的软件,用户完全控制私钥,相对安全,但如果电脑感染了病毒或木马软件,安全性会大幅下降。常例的有Exodus与Electrum等。 - 移动: 移动则是为智能手机设计的应用,如Trust Wallet、Coinomi等。它们方便携带和使用,但因为手机的各种安全隐患可能增加被盗的风险。适合日常小额交易。如何在以太坊中发币
一旦选择了合适的,接下来的步骤便是如何通过这个发币。在以太坊上发币通常涉及创建一个新的智能合约,智能合约将决定代币的属性,比如总供应量、名称、符号等。
1. 选择合约标准: 在以太坊上发币通常会遵循ERC20或ERC721标准。ERC20是一种广泛使用的代币标准,适合大多数代币发行;而ERC721则主要用于非同质化代币(NFT)。根据所需功能选择合适的标准至关重要。 2. 开发智能合约: 开发智能合约可以使用以太坊合约编程语言Solidity。用户可以自行编写合约代码,或使用现有模板进行修改。合约需确保功能完整且无漏洞,保证代币的正常运行。 3. 部署合约: 将开发好的智能合约部署到以太坊主网上。部署时需要支付“矿工费用”,这通常是以链上交易的形式进行。合约部署完成后,用户获取一个地址,其他人可以通过这个地址与代币交互。 4. 测试合约: 在主网上发币之前,建议在以太坊的测试网络(如Ropsten、Rinkeby等)上进行测试,确保合约功能正常,没有致命缺陷。测试完成后再考虑部署到主网。发币过程中需要注意的事项
在以太坊上发币并不是一件简单的事情,用户在操作时需要注意以下
- 合约安全性: 安全性是发币最重要的考虑之一。用户在编写合约时务必遵循最佳实践,使用成熟的开发框架,并且在发布前进行多次审计,以减少安全漏洞的可能性。 - 交易费用: 在以太坊上,所有交易都需要支付一定的gas费用,特别是在网络繁忙时,费用可能会显著增加。要考虑到这一点,确保在发币时有充足的ETH用于支付gas费用。 - 法律合规: 在某些国家和地区,发币可能受到法律监管。用户在发币之前要确保符合相关法律法规的要求,以免日后遭受法律追责。 - 社群建设: 发币不只是技术问题,还是一个社区建设的过程。发币后,要积极进行市场推广和投资者关系管理,吸引用户使用和交易你的代币。常见问题解答
1. 以太坊哪个好?选择合适的取决于个人需求。对于新手,MetaMask作为浏览器扩展非常友好,便于链接去中心化应用(dApps)。而对于长期持有,Ledger或Trezor硬件则较为适合。此外,如果需要频繁交易及发币,移动或热也是不错的选择.
2. 如何保证发币合约的安全?合约安全是发币过程中最重要的环节。建议仔细阅读和应用开源合约的设计理念,并进行多次测试。在合约部署前,使用专业的安全审计服务检查合约代码,确保没有漏洞或安全隐患。此外,在合约中加入紧急停止机制(如上锁)可以在出现问题时保护用户资产。
3. 发币需要哪些技术知识?发币涉及一定的编程知识,尤其是Solidity语言。同时,了解以太坊网络的基本机制和运作是必不可少的。用户需要掌握合约的部署流程,包括使用区块链浏览器(如Etherscan)跟踪合约状态的技能。此外,了解市场营销和投资者关系也是发币成功的重要一环。
4. 发币后如何进行市场推广?市场推广是发币不可忽视的部分。用户可以通过社交媒体、区块链论坛、加密货币社区(如Reddit、Telegram等)进行宣传。此外,撰写有关项目的白皮书,参与社区活动,甚至通过空投等方式吸引用户都是有效的推广策略。借力各种线上线下活动进行全面宣传,以增强社群凝聚力与代币交易的活跃度。
综上所述,发币是一项复杂但充满机会的活动,选择合适的与合约至关重要。无论你是初学者还是经验丰富的开发者,了解每一项步骤及其安全性都是成功的关键。